MONTREAL, QUEBEC--(Marketwired - Sept. 2, 2016) - MDN Inc. (the "Company") (TSX VENTURE:MDN) is pleased to
announce the voting results of its special shareholder meeting held on September 1, 2016.
1. Consolidation of common shares
Shareholders of the Company voted to authorize the adoption of a special resolution by the board of directors for the
consolidation of the common shares of the Company on the basis of five (5) common shares for one (1) common share. The
consolidation of the common shares was accepted by a majority of the votes, as follows:

2. Name change
Shareholders of the Company voted to authorize the adoption of a special resolution by the board of directors to change the
name of the Company from « MDN Inc. » to « Les Métaux Niobay inc. / Niobay Metals Inc. ». The name change was accepted by a
majority of the votes, as follows:

It is expected that these resolutions will be in effect over the coming weeks.
Claude Dufresne, CEO of MDN commented: "We are very pleased with the support of our shareholders for the adoption of these
special resolutions. The new image of the Company will enhance the development of the James Bay Niobium project".
About MDN (TSX VENTURE:MDN)
MDN Inc. is a mining exploration company that recently acquired the James Bay Niobium property in Ontario, Canada. MDN also
holds a 72.5% interest in Crevier Minerals Inc., which owns a niobium tantalum resource in Quebec, Canada and the Ikungu and
Ikungu East Gold properties in Tanzania.
